About flights from Caticlan (MPH)

Caticlan's airport is small — like, really small. But don't let that fool you. Godofredo P. Ramos Airport (MPH) punches well above its weight because it's essentially the front door to Boracay, one of the most talked-about islands in Southeast Asia. You land, hop a short tricycle ride to the jetty, take a 10-minute boat across, and suddenly you're on White Beach. The whole transfer takes maybe 30 minutes. I've done it myself and honestly? The convenience factor is unreal.

Why fly to Caticlan?

With 5 direct routes, all within the Philippines, MPH keeps things focused — and that's actually its strength. You're not overwhelmed with options; you're connected to exactly the places that matter for a Filipino island-hopping trip. The shortest hop is Cebu City at just 285 km, which makes a Visayas island loop genuinely easy to plan. Manila is the obvious workhorse route, served by multiple carriers including Cebu Pacific (5J) and Philippine Airlines (PR). And if you want to push further south, there's a direct flight to Davao — the longest route at 669 km — which opens up Mindanao without backtracking through the capital. That's a routing most travelers don't even realize exists.

Tips for travelers at MPH

The airport itself has limited amenities, so eat before you fly — seriously, don't count on a proper meal here. Arrive early during peak season (December through April) because Boracay crowds mean everything, including check-in queues, gets chaotic fast. Getting from MPH to Boracay means a tricycle to Caticlan Jetty Port, then a bangka boat to Cagban Pier. Budget roughly 100-150 PHP for the trike and another 100 PHP for the boat. Airlines like AirAsia Philippines (Z2) often have the best deals if you book three to four weeks ahead.

Frequently asked questions about flying to Caticlan

How do I get from Godofredo P (MPH) airport to Caticlan city center?

You can take a tricycle or taxi from the airport, which is only about 2-3 km away and costs around 150-300 PHP. Many hotels also offer airport shuttle services, so it's worth checking with your accommodation in advance.

What's the best time to fly to Caticlan?

The dry season from November to May offers the best weather for your trip, with December to February being peak tourist season. If you prefer fewer crowds and lower prices, consider traveling in the shoulder months of October or June.

How many destinations can I reach directly from Caticlan airport?

Godofredo P (MPH) has 5 direct flight destinations, making it a convenient hub for reaching nearby islands and cities without connections. This is perfect if you're island-hopping around the Visayas region.

Do I need a visa to enter the Philippines through Caticlan?

Most visitors from Western countries get a 30-day visa exemption upon arrival, but it's best to check your country's specific requirements with the Philippine embassy. Make sure your passport is valid for at least 6 months beyond your travel dates.

What should I know about Godofredo P airport itself?

The airport is quite small and easy to get through, but facilities are limited, so grab snacks and drinks before your flight. There's an ATM available, but it's wise to have some cash on hand since card payments aren't accepted everywhere.

How much should I budget for flights to/from Caticlan?

Domestic flights from Manila typically range from 1,500-3,500 PHP depending on how far in advance you book, while international flights vary widely by origin. Flying mid-week and booking 2-3 weeks ahead usually gets you better rates than weekend travel.
